Common Genie Garage Door Problems We Solve in Escondido
- Excelerator screw-drive rails gummed to a halt. The original lubricant in 1970s and 1980s Genie screw-drive openers turns to waxy abrasive after decades of Escondido’s 100°F summer peaks. In 92027’s tract homes, we regularly find carriages that jerk, stall, or squeal because the rail hasn’t been cleaned and relubricated since installation. Replacement rail-and-carriage assemblies solve it when the wear is too deep.
- QuietLift logic boards fried by inland lightning. Santa Ana wind events in Escondido’s valley often carry electrical storms that coastal cities miss. The power surges that follow have killed more Genie QuietLift logic boards here than anywhere else we service. We install OEM replacement boards with surge protection recommendations.
- Photo-eye misalignment from slab settling and wind racking. 1960s ranch homes in 92025 and 92027 have settled enough that door frames shift seasonally. Add a 50 mph Santa Ana gust, and Genie photo-eyes that were barely aligned go fully offline. We realign with shimming and reinforced brackets, not just tape-and-hope adjustments.
- Aladdin Connect Wi-Fi dropouts in hillside dead zones. The newer 92026 developments with their terrain-hugging layouts often have router placement that leaves garage corners signal-starved. Genie’s smart opener needs consistent 2.4 GHz bandwidth. We diagnose whether it’s a range issue, interference, or firmware, and we won’t sell you a smart upgrade if your garage is a connectivity hole.
- Bottom seals cracked years ahead of schedule. Escondido’s stronger inland UV and freeze-thaw cycling dry out rubber faster than manufacturer specs assume. We stock Genie-compatible seals cut to the non-standard widths common in older Escondido single-car garages.
Genie Service in Escondido: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ment
Escondido’s 1960s tract homes in 92025 and 92027 often have original Genie screw-drive openers mounted on single-car garages with only 7-foot headroom. Standard low-headroom conversion brackets (Genie part #38934S) work, but the rail almost always needs custom trimming because the garage depth is 18 feet instead of the modern 22-foot standard. We’ve learned to measure twice and cut once on these jobs, carrying rails we can field-modify without ordering special lengths. The Santa Ana winds that funnel through this valley don’t just rattle doors; they test every bracket and hinge we install. That’s why we use reinforced steel gear options on replacement openers for Escondido customers, even when the base model ships with nylon. The extra $60 in parts cost beats a callback when the next heatwave hits.

Standard cycle ratings assume moderate climates. Escondido’s extreme thermal cycling and Santa Ana wind loading stress springs beyond spec. We typically see 7–9 years instead of the rated 10–15, especially on doors facing west that absorb afternoon heat. Our spring replacements use heavier-gauge wire rated for the actual load.
